2024 年全球氦-3 同位素市場規模估計為 1,562 萬美元,預計在預測期(2025-2031 年)內將以 18.6% 的複合年成長率成長,到 2031 年達到 4,945 萬美元。

本報告對近期有關氦-3同位素跨境工業佈局、資本配置模式、區域經濟相互依存以及供應鏈重組的關稅調整和國際戰略反制措施進行了全面評估。

2024年,全球氦-3產量達到約5,387公升,全球平均市場價格約為每公升2,900美元。截至2024年,全球氦-3總產能達8,200公升。

氦-3是氦的一種穩定同位素,其原子核由兩個質子和一個中子組成。它具有獨特的超流性、極低的沸點以及與中子發生核反應的能力。氦-3在地球上極為稀少,主要存在於月壤和太陽風沉積物中。它被認為是製造氦-3中子檢測器、稀釋製冷機和醫學影像診斷設備的重要材料。

全球對氦-3同位素的市場需求正經歷著穩定且持續的成長,這主要歸功於其在國家安全、先進醫療和前沿研究中不可替代的作用。在國防和安全領域,反恐和防止核擴散挑戰使得基於氦-3的高靈敏度中子檢測器成為邊防安全和非法核材料監測的關鍵組件,從而推動了各國採購需求的持續成長。在高科技領域,超極化氦-3氣體為無輻射、高解析度肺部磁振造影(MRI)提供了理想的解決方案,推動了精準醫療市場的擴張。此外,作為實現接近絕對零度低溫的關鍵介質,氦-3對於量子電腦稀釋製冷機和眾多基礎科學研究計劃至關重要。這種需求的激增為市場注入了新的活力。

全球氦-3同位素供應呈現高度集中化的特徵,表現為寡占和地緣政治控制。目前,陸地氦-3同位素供應幾乎完全依賴核武產物氚的崩壞,並且嚴重依賴擁有大量核武庫存的國家。俄羅斯和美國等國控制全球大部分供應和蘊藏量,從而設置了極高的市場進入障礙。由於氦-3同位素資源的稀缺性和戰略重要性,國際間對其資源的競爭日益激烈。除了爭奪現有的陸地資源外,各國也將目光轉向太空資源。美國、中國和俄羅斯等航太強國正在加速推進月球探勘計劃,以檢驗並可能爭奪月球上儲量超過一百萬噸的氦-3資源。

技術創新正成為推動氦-3同位素產業發展的核心動力。同時,應用技術的創新也不斷開拓新的市場領域。例如,更有效率、更精準的肺部氣體磁振造影技術促進了氦-3同位素在精準醫療市場的應用。此外,利用效率的提升和對替代解決方案的探索也在顯著改變產業的格局。

由於氦-3同位素極為稀缺,其價格長期以來居高不下,但一系列技術進步緩解了成本壓力。在使用者方面,設備設計和材料的改進顯著提高了氦-3同位素的利用效率和回收率,有效降低了終端用戶的平均年度使用成本。

The global market for Helium-3 Isotope was estimated to be worth US$ 15.62 million in 2024 and is forecast to a readjusted size of US$ 49.45 million by 2031 with a CAGR of 18.6% during the forecast period 2025-2031.

This report provides a comprehensive assessment of recent tariff adjustments and international strategic countermeasures on Helium-3 Isotope cross-border industrial footprints, capital allocation patterns, regional economic interdependencies, and supply chain reconfigurations.

In 2024, global Helium-3 Isotope production reached approximately 5,387 liters, with an average global market price of around US$ 2900 per liter.In 2024, the global total helium-3 isotope production capacity reached 8,200 liters.

Helium-3 Isotope is a stable isotope of helium, with a nucleus composed of two protons and one neutron. It possesses unique superfluidity, an extremely low boiling point, and the ability to undergo nuclear reactions with neutrons. It is extremely rare on Earth, primarily found in lunar soil and solar wind deposits. It is considered a crucial material for helium-3 neutron detectors, dilution refrigerators, and medical imaging.

The global market demand for helium-3 isotopes is experiencing strong and sustained growth, driven primarily by its irreplaceable role in national security, cutting-edge medicine, and cutting-edge scientific research. In terms of national defense and security, the critical global challenges of counterterrorism and nuclear non-proliferation have made high-sensitivity neutron detectors based on helium-3 an essential component for border security and monitoring illicit nuclear materials, leading to a steady increase in procurement demand from various countries. In the high-tech sector, hyperpolarized helium-3 gas provides the ultimate solution for radiation-free, high-definition lung magnetic resonance imaging (MRI), driving its expansion in the precision medicine market. Furthermore, as the core medium for achieving near-absolute zero temperatures, it is essential for quantum computer dilution refrigerators and numerous basic scientific research projects, and this surge in demand has injected new momentum into the market.

The global supply of helium-3 isotopes is characterized by extreme concentration, characterized by oligopoly and geopolitical dominance. Currently, Earth's helium-3 isotope supply comes almost entirely from the decay of tritium, a byproduct of nuclear weapons, making its supply highly dependent on countries with large nuclear arsenals. Russia, the United States, and other countries control the vast majority of global supply and reserves, creating extremely high market barriers. This scarcity and strategic importance have led to increasingly fierce international competition for helium-3 isotope resources. Countries are not only competing for existing Earth reserves but are also turning their attention to space. Space powers such as the United States, China, and Russia are accelerating lunar exploration programs to verify and potentially compete for the lunar helium-3 resources estimated to exceed one million tons.

Technological innovation is becoming a core driver of the helium-3 isotope industry upgrade. On the one hand, innovations in applied technologies are continuously opening up new market areas. For example, more efficient and accurate lung gas magnetic resonance imaging technology has promoted the application of helium-3 isotopes in the precision medicine market. On the other hand, improvements in utilization efficiency and the exploration of alternative solutions are also profoundly changing the industry landscape.

Although helium-3 isotope prices have long remained sky-high due to its extreme scarcity, a series of technological advances are working to alleviate cost pressures. On the user side, improvements in equipment design and materials have significantly increased the utilization efficiency and recycling rate of helium-3 isotopes, effectively reducing the average annual cost of use for end users.
